## Deployment: Hot-Reloading Config

As discussed in last week's sync, Larkspur now reloads its configuration without a restart. The watcher polls the mounted config volume every ten seconds and applies changes atomically; invalid files are rejected and the previous snapshot stays active. Please verify reload events in the audit log after each rollout. The currently active values on the staging pods are as follows.

settings of kagup-tagug:
ULAIX_HOST=ulaix.zemvarsys.internal
ULAIX_PORT=8000

Ticket: Config drift on Spoolfern workers. While replacing the homegrown job queue with the new broker, we found the three worker hosts running divergent settings — retry limits and dead-letter routing differ from what the repo declares. This undermines the audit trail the security review depends on. Remediation is to re-provision from source. The intended canonical configuration is recorded below.

service settings:
novath:
  pin: 1396
  tenant: pelys
  seal: seal_ccc035e1
  metrics_host: metrics.novath.qorvelworks.test
  standby_team: fraeth
  escalation: drueth-zorok
  nonce: 61d508

Support folks: the Pylet sidecar flushes aggregated metrics on an
interval, not per-event. Gaps in dashboards shorter than one flush
window are expected, not bugs. Buffer overflows drop oldest samples
first. Before filing a ticket, compare the customer's symptoms against
these defaults, which the sidecar ships with:

tuning table, yajog-yahof:
BUDGETS = {
    "lamvan": 303,
    "wenox": 460,
    "fenvan": 525,
}

**Vendor note: Inkmill markdown pipeline**

Rendering for Parchway docs is outsourced to Inkmill under an annual contract, renewing each March. They handle sanitization and PDF export; we own the upload queue. SLA: 4-hour response on rendering failures. Escalate only after two failed retries. Their support desk is reachable at the address below.

billing contact of hahaf-baguf = zorael.tammir.jorius@sivrelhq.internal